- Add the mustard seeds to some heated sesame oil. When the mustard seeds start sputtering, add the fenugreek, onion, garlic, curry leaves and the green chillies
- After a couple of minutes, add the drumsticks. Saute for a few minutes and add the spice powders: turmeric, chillie and coriander powder. Give it a good stir and allow it to cook and let the spices cook and become fragrant
- Next add the tomatoes, and about 1/2 cup of water and let it cook. Once the drumsticks have cooked, add the tamarind juice
- Season with salt if needed, and reduce the heat to low. Add the coconut milk, the cumin powder, mix and remove from the heat. Garnish with some coriander leaves
- Serve this along with some freshly made white rice
